Tidigare FBI-chef ska utreda rysskoppling

Det amerikanska justitiedepartementet har tillsatt en särskild åklagare som ska utreda den ryska inblandningen i det amerikanska presidentvalet och Trumpstabens kontakter med Ryssland. Det rapporterar flera amerikanska medier.

– Jag anser att det här är i det amerikanska folkets intresse, säger biträdande justitieminister Rod Rosenstein i ett uttalande.

Det blir den förre FBI-chefen Robert Mueller som ska leda utredningen. New York Times skriver att beslutet gör att insatserna för Donald Trump höjs rejält. En särskild åklagare har mycket större befogenheter att oberoende sköta utredningen, skriver tidningen.

Donald Trump kommenterade beslutet i natt, svensk tid. ”Jag ser fram emot att de snabbt kommer till en slutsats i det här ärendet”, säger han i ett uttalande.

Särskild åklagare

A special prosecutor (or special counsel or independent counsel) is a lawyer appointed to investigate and possibly prosecute a specific legal case of potential wrongdoing for which a conflict of interest exists for the usual prosecuting authority. For example, the investigation of an allegation against a sitting president or attorney-general might be handled by a special prosecutor rather than an ordinary prosecutor, who would otherwise be in the position of investigating their own boss. Investigations into others connected to the government but not in a position of direct authority over the prosecutor, such as cabinet secretaries or election campaigns, have also been handled by special prosecutors. The term is not specific to the United States, or to the federal government. According to Harriger, the concept originates in state law: "state courts have traditionally appointed special prosecutors when the regular government attorney was disqualified from a case, whether for incapacitation or interest." While the most prominent special prosecutors have been those appointed since the 1870s to investigate presidents and those connected to them, the term can also be used to refer to any prosecutor appointed to avoid a conflict of interest or appearance thereof. For example, because district attorneys' offices work closely with police, some activists argue that cases of police misconduct at the state and local level should be handled by "special prosecutors".

Robert Mueller

Robert Swan Mueller III (born August 7, 1944) is an American lawyer who was the sixth Director of the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) for 12 years, between September 4, 2001 and September 4, 2013. On May 17, 2017, Deputy Attorney General Rod J. Rosenstein appointed Mueller to serve as special counsel to oversee the investigation into Russian interference in the 2016 United States elections, and investigations into ties between Russia and the Donald Trump campaign.
